## The Power of Viral Content
In today’s digital age, anyone has the potential to become famous overnight thanks to the power of viral content. Whether it’s a funny video, a quirky meme, or a controversial statement, the internet has a way of taking something seemingly insignificant and turning it into a global sensation. Here are a few examples of individuals who achieved fame through viral content:
– “Cash Me Outside” Girl: Danielle Bregoli became a household name after her appearance on the Dr. Phil show went viral. Despite lacking any discernible talent, her catchphrase “Cash me ousside, how bout dat?” made her an internet sensation and landed her a lucrative career in the entertainment industry.
– Alex from Target: In 2014, a photo of a teenage Target employee named Alex surfaced on Twitter and quickly went viral. Overnight, Alex became a social media sensation and was approached by numerous brands for endorsement deals, simply for being in the right place at the right time.
– Chewbacca Mom: Candace Payne became an internet sensation after she posted a video of herself trying on a Chewbacca mask and laughing hysterically. The video garnered millions of views and turned her into an overnight celebrity, leading to numerous media appearances and endorsement deals.
## Riding the Wave of Controversy
Another way some individuals have achieved fame without talent is by stirring up controversy and capturing the public’s attention. While this approach may not always be sustainable, it has proven to be effective for some. Here are a few examples of individuals who gained fame through controversy:
– Kim Kardashian: While Kim Kardashian is now a household name, her rise to fame began with a controversial leaked sex tape. Despite lacking traditional talent, Kim used the scandal to her advantage and parlayed it into a successful reality TV career and business empire.
– Tana Mongeau: Tana rose to fame through her controversial and often outrageous behavior on social media. By being unapologetically herself and courting controversy, she amassed a large following and eventually transitioned into a successful career as a YouTuber and influencer.
– Logan and Jake Paul: The Paul brothers achieved fame through their controversial and often controversial antics on social media. While their behavior may not be universally liked, it undeniably propelled them to fame and success in the entertainment industry.
